CBS mock draft has Saints taking USC linebacker
March 20, 2008
Posted by Tom Planchet | 9:20 AM
Star linebacker Keith Rivers of USC will be the choice of the Saints in the NFL draft, according to CBS Sportsline's mock draft. That would be a lot of linebacker help since he'd join Dan Morgan and Jonathan Vilma.
